Winter Weather Advisory starts 4 PM Tuesday

West Michigan – A Winter Weather Advisory has been issued for parts of our area for lake-effect snow. The advisory will go into effect at 4 PM Tuesday and continue until 10 AM Thursday for mainly the lakeshore counties.

Our Future Track computer model for 6 PM Tuesday shows lake-effect snow increasing along and west of US 131. Winds will be west-northwest so the heaviest snow will fall west and southwest of Grand Rapids.

The lake-effect snow will continue on Wednesday with winds remaining mainly west-northwest. The snow showers will start to diminish overnight Wednesday as moisture becomes limited.

Snowfall totals by Thursday will range from 1-3 inches east of US 131. Heavier snow is expected along the lakeshore with 3-6 inches in most areas. Some snowfall totals southwest of Grand Rapids will likely be over 6 inches.
